Output 586953db46a6e110005b28e0f70940aba71fe5d30909a084448ad96e0f5be02f:0

value
93119570965
script pubkey
OP_0 OP_PUSHBYTES_20 d7df943c12d864a9a20242ed32a39e20b3a04c36
address
ltc1q6l0eg0qjmpj2ngszgtkn9gu7yze6qnpkqpjj0t
transaction
586953db46a6e110005b28e0f70940aba71fe5d30909a084448ad96e0f5be02f
spent
true